One strategy that has gained attention in recent years is single stage evacuation.

single stage evacuation is a method where all individuals are evacuated from a building or area at once, typically through one designated exit point. This approach differs from phased evacuation, where people are evacuated in stages based on their location or level within a building. While single stage evacuation may sound simplistic, it has proven to be an effective and efficient method of evacuating large groups of people during emergencies.

One of the key benefits of single stage evacuation is its simplicity and ease of implementation. In a high-stress situation such as a fire or earthquake, having a straightforward evacuation plan can greatly reduce confusion and panic among individuals. With single stage evacuation, there is a clear and direct path to safety, allowing for a faster and more organized evacuation process.
